Pros
Pro Great Content
Engaging hands on content that is written by industry experts and updated frequently.
Pro Build a portfolio as your learn
The Odin Project is a project-based curriculum which means you are able to build projects for your portfolio as you work through the sections.
Pro Free and open source
The Odin Project is a completely free and open source alternative to coding bootcamps.
Cons
Con Price and availability
The online courses are only available in two time zones, EST and PST. The courses are on the higher end.
Con Light on CS
The Odin Project touches on computer science concepts, such as data structures. However the explanations are quite light and something you'll want to learn more about from other resources.
